V. Hãy đọc đoạn văn sau và trả lời câu hỏi.

Portmouth is a town in England. It is in the south of England and it is on the coast. Off the coat, near Portsmouth, there is an island called the Isle of Wight. This island is south of Portsmouth. It is famous for water sports. The Isle of Wight is beautiful and it has a warm climate. Every year, thousands of people come here for sightseeing for sailing.

Where is Portsmouth?

=> Portsmouth is in the South of England.

Is the Isle of Wight south or north of Portsmouth?

=> It is south of Portsmouth.

What is the Isle of Wight famous for?

=> The Isle of Wight is famous for water sports.

What is the weather in the Isle of Wight?

=> It is warm.

Why do many people come to the Isle of Wight every year?

=> Many people come to the Isle of Wight every year for sightseeing and for sailing.
